At Maithan ESI Hospital is located. This Hospital is having 110 beds. Big Building with acres of land in prime location. This hospital is run by Jharkhand State Govt and most of the times could not cater the needs of Insured persons due to lack of Doctors, pathological Deptt, Surgery Depatt, and many others . For tis lack of facility working people covered under ESI dont get treatment even in simple fracture case or surgery case. If ESIC takes over this Hospital run this Hospital directly by ESI

Contd. The Civil Hospitals, first of all, are absolutely out of tune with the ever increasing populace of the areas they have been establish to cater to. Hence, whatever facilities are there with them are not sufficient to serve those who turn up to avail them. Even the man-power is enough. Needless to emphasise, there is urgent need to, up-grade the existing Civil Hoapitals as also, to increase their numbers IN PROPORTION TO THE POPULATION OF THE AREA THEY ARE EXPECTED TO SERVE. IT IS IMP.
